Transaction 81076efec5bd40fb79b629628b39db281e1ab688477d2e38fbf24ade128e0471
1 Input
2 Outputs
- 81076efec5bd40fb79b629628b39db281e1ab688477d2e38fbf24ade128e0471:0
- 81076efec5bd40fb79b629628b39db281e1ab688477d2e38fbf24ade128e0471:1
value 1100000
address 1K1TGDYbaiZSqE4aaUxHcoC2gr3xZDLgtv
value 50375555
address 3QULho7wHjRVA5Vn3RH6yR1ZxPtFjKqKnA